Subject: Postmortem summary — stale-cache bug affecting plugin manifests

Dear plugin authors, last week the Orbiq platform served stale plugin manifests for roughly six hours due to a cache-invalidation flaw in our registry layer. Updated plugins appeared unpublished to some users. The fix ensures manifest writes purge all regional caches synchronously. No plugin code changes are required on your side. The patched release can be verified against the build token below.

pipeline stamp: htk6_7941f2

Handover note — discount policy, large deals. From Director Sela Norgaard to Director Ivo Prentice. Branch managers should note the interim rules: deals above the large-deal threshold require regional sign-off; standard discounts cap at 18%; anything higher goes to Ivo's desk. The old matrix from the Calverton office is withdrawn. Exceptions granted before this week remain valid through quarter end. Questions route through your regional lead. The confidential business-plan note appears immediately below.

confidential, kagep-kahof: Druokax Systems plans to lower the Ulaath list price by 53 percent in March.

### Step 4: Migrate the reminder job

The Larchmede clinic reminder job moves from the legacy scheduler to the new worker pool this week. It scans tomorrow's appointments at 06:00 and enqueues SMS and email notices. Before cutover, confirm the dedupe table was copied and the retry counter resets correctly. The worker reads appointment data directly from the patient-scheduling replica, reachable via the connection string below.

replica DSN, kajep-yahag: mssql://praok_svc:iF@db-8d68.plorvaio.local:5432/eliion

Subject: DR drill summary — GC pauses in Matchwright

For your review: during Tuesday's disaster-recovery drill, the Matchwright matching service exhibited garbage-collection pauses of up to 1.4 seconds under replayed peak load, long enough to trip the failover detector and trigger an unplanned region swap. We have tuned heap sizing and re-run the scenario without incident. The full pause logs are in the sealed drill archive, retained for your audit. The archive opens with the recovery passphrase provided immediately below.

vault phrase of bafop-bagep = holael-quenwyn